HPSBMU03217 rev.1 - HP Vertica Analytics Platform running Bash Shell, Remote
Code Execution

NOTICE: The information in this Security Bulletin should be acted upon as
soon as possible.

Release Date: 2014-12-16
Last Updated: 2014-12-16

Potential Security Impact: Remote code execution

Source: Hewlett-Packard Company, HP Software Security Response Team

VULNERABILITY SUMMARY
A potential security vulnerability has been identified with HP Vertica. This
is the Bash Shell vulnerability known as "ShellShock" which could be
exploited remotely to allow execution of code.

References:

CVE-2014-6271
CVE-2014-6277
CVE-2014-6278
CVE-2014-7169
CVE-2014-7186
CVE-2014-7187
SSRT101827

SUPPORTED SOFTWARE VERSIONS*: ONLY impacted versions are listed.

HP Vertica AMI's and Virtual Machines prior to v7.1.1-0.

BACKGROUND

HP Vertica AMI's and Virtual Machines prior to v7.1.1-0 include a vulnerable
version of the Bash shell.

CVSS 2.0 Base Metrics
===========================================================
Reference Base Vector Base Score
CVE-2014-6271 (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:C/I:C/A:C) 10.0
CVE-2104-6277 (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:C/I:C/A:C) 10.0
CVE-2104-6278 (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:C/I:C/A:C) 10.0
CVE-2014-7169 (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:C/I:C/A:C) 10.0
CVE-2014-7186 (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:C/I:C/A:C) 10.0
CVE-2014-7187 (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:C/I:C/A:C) 10.0
===========================================================
Information on CVSS is documented
in HP Customer Notice: HPSN-2008-002

RESOLUTION

We recommend installing Vertica v7.1.1-0 or subsequent, or manually
installing a new version of Bash, such as Bash43-027.

HP has released the following updates to resolve this vulnerability for HP
Vertica products.

Update to the latest VM image available at: https://my.vertica.com

For customers using the AMI version HP Vertica Analytics platform, please
install the latest image available at Amazon.
